This paper discusses the basic concepts of models and modelling. The difference in information contents between a model and the real or imagined situation it is intended to represent is pointed out, and the fact that a model should not be divorced from its intended purpose is strongly emphasized. The act of modelling is defined and discussed. It is concluded that even though formalized approaches to modelling (such as the systems approach) exists ; modelling, as well as the use of models, remains very much an art rather than a science.

The necessary and sufficient conditions for the completion of a class of pursuit— evasion games are given. The state variables of the pursuer are assumed to be defined by a set of linear differential equations and the evader's state variables are given by a vector valued non-linear differential equation. The game is defined to be completed if certain (or all) state variables of the pursuer ; i.e. position, velocity, etc. are equal to the corresponding state variables of the evader. The Krein's L-method is used to determine the existence of the optimal completion time and the optimal player strategies. The general results are specialized to the case in which the evader's state vector is also governed by a set of linear differential equations. A computational technique—steepest descent method has been developed to obtain the numerical solution of the game. Three examples are presented to illustrate the method. The first one deals with a linear, second order, pursuit-evasion game with constant coefficients in which completion occurs when the position component of the player's state vector coincide. A second linear example is selected to illustrate the effectiveness with which the approach developed in this paper can be used to obtain a sub-optimal solution even if the exact solution cannot be achieved. In the last example, a non-linear pursuit–evasion game is considered. Here it is shown that the technique developed may be applied to a certain class of non-linear pursuit–evasion game although the procedures are much more involved.

Several algorithms based on the multiplier or augmented penalty function method for minimizing a function subject to equality constraints are surveyed and compared numerically. These methods employ an approximation of the Lagrange multiplier to increase efficiency. A revised method for choosing the multiplier is presented and compared numerically with the other algorithms. One scheme for automatically choosing the penalty constant associated with the algorithms is also presented.
